Laid Off? Start With Stability, Not Panic
Being laid off can feel personal, even when it is not.
One day you have a paycheck, benefits, retirement contributions, life insurance, disability coverage, and a routine. Then suddenly, several pieces of your financial life may be changing at once.
If you were recently laid off in Salt Lake City, elsewhere in Utah, or anywhere in the country, the first goal is not to solve everything immediately.
The first goal is stability.
You need to know what money is coming in, what money is going out, what benefits may be ending, what deadlines matter, and what can wait until your income is stable again.f
